About 2-butoxy-4-morpholin-4-yl-5-propoxyaniline;methyl (2Z)-2-amino-2-(1-methyl-2-pyridinylidene)acetate

2-butoxy-4-morpholin-4-yl-5-propoxyaniline;methyl (2Z)-2-amino-2-(1-methyl-2-pyridinylidene)acetate (PubChem CID 143569080) has the molecular formula C26H40N4O5 and a molecular weight of 488.63 g/mol. Its IUPAC name is 2-butoxy-4-morpholin-4-yl-5-propoxyaniline;methyl (2Z)-2-amino-2-(1-methyl-2-pyridinylidene)acetate.
